/// <summary>
/// Scrolls the specified item into view.
/// </summary>
/// <param name="index">The index of the item.</param>
public void ScrollIntoView(int index)
{
if (index < 0 || index >= VirtualControlCount)
throw new ArgumentOutOfRangeException(nameof(index));
int firstVisible = FirstVisibleVirtualIndex;
int lastVisible = firstVisible + (DisplayHeight / VirtualControlHeight) - 1;
if (index < firstVisible)
{
SetScrollPosition(index * VirtualControlHeight);
}
else if (index > lastVisible)
{
int newScrollPos = (index - (lastVisible - firstVisible)) * VirtualControlHeight;
SetScrollPosition(newScrollPos);
}
}
